Description

Join our team and what we'll accomplish together

Join the Digital Experiences team and have fun making a difference for our customers through exceptional content.
The Digital Experiences team is seeking an L4 Content Manager for an exciting role that will allow us to drive best-in-class content experiences across telus.com. The successful candidate will be a key member supporting customer engagement through strategic content management and innovative digital experiences. In this role, you will oversee content workflows while mentoring team members and implementing process improvements that deliver measurable impact.

What you'll do

You'll be working with a cross section of teams and stakeholders across TELUS Digital Experiences. You will be the central figure in creating exceptional content experiences for telus.com and gaining cross-functional alignment to ensure content excellence.
As a natural proactive leader, you will work with multiple stakeholders and business units to drive content strategy, evolving our content practices to meet current market dynamics while also delivering exceptional customer experiences. You will play a critical role in our digital content strategy, embracing ambiguity and initiating opportunities to develop this role to its full potential.

Here's how


  • Create, edit, and publish high-quality content for telus.com while maintaining brand compliance and ensuring exceptional customer experiences
  • Lead strategic content initiatives by identifying process improvements, mentoring team members, and implementing scalable content solutions
  • Collaborate with design, development, and marketing teams to align content with business objectives and deliver seamless customer journeys
  • Use data analysis and user insights to inform content decisions, optimize performance, and present recommendations to stakeholders
  • Champion personalization initiatives and content innovation while ensuring accessibility standards and SEO best practices
  • Foster a collaborative team environment by conducting content audits, managing publishing schedules, and supporting hiring activities

Qualifications


What you bring


  • 5+ years of hands-on content management experience with web content management systems and proven track record in content strategy
  • Strong writing, editing, and proofreading skills with experience in content audits, SEO optimization, and accessibility standards
  • Demonstrated ability to think strategically about content and processes with strong analytical skills using data to inform decisions
  • Experience mentoring team members with excellent communication, presentation, and cross-functional collaboration skills
  • Proven track record of process improvement, problem-solving, and managing content workflows and publishing processes
  • Knowledge of HTML, basic web technologies, content tools, and familiarity with quality assurance processes
